The Paint Absorbent Market size was valued at USD 2.5 Billion in 2022 and is projected to reach USD 4.1 Billion by 2030, growing at a CAGR of 7.2% from 2024 to 2030.
The Paint Absorbent market is a specialized industry driven by the need for innovative and eco-friendly solutions to manage excess paints, spills, and oversprays. The market primarily serves industries that deal with large-scale applications of paints and coatings, such as civil construction and electronics. Paint absorbents are materials designed to soak up excess or spilled paints, preventing environmental damage and facilitating cleanup. Growth in Eco-friendly Solutions: The demand for biodegradable and eco-friendly paint absorbents is on the rise due to increasing environmental concerns and stricter regulations on waste disposal.
Advancements in Material Science: There has been a notable shift toward developing absorbent materials with improved performance, such as better paint retention and faster absorption times, to meet the needs of diverse industries.
Automation in Cleanup Processes: The integration of automated systems for managing paint spills and oversprays is a growing trend in industries like civil construction and electronics, further driving the demand for high-efficiency absorbents.
Customizable Absorbent Products: Companies are increasingly focusing on providing customized paint absorbent solutions tailored to specific applications, offering greater flexibility in handling different types of paints and coatings.
Regulatory Compliance: As environmental regulations become stricter, industries are increasingly adopting paint absorbents to meet legal requirements for waste management and pollution control.
Expansion in Emerging Markets: With rapid industrialization in regions like Asia Pacific, there is significant potential for market growth, particularly in countries where manufacturing and construction activities are on the rise.
Increased Focus on Sustainability: Manufacturers are exploring new ways to produce eco-friendly, biodegradable absorbents, presenting opportunities for companies that focus on green innovations.
Collaborations with Industry Leaders: Strategic partnerships with companies in the construction and electronics industries could help paint absorbent manufacturers access larger markets and enhance product visibility.
Rising Demand for Non-Toxic Products: As safety and health concerns grow, the demand for non-toxic and hypoallergenic absorbent materials is expected to increase, creating opportunities for companies to cater to this niche market.
Integration with Smart Technologies: The incorporation of sensors and smart features into paint absorbent products could further improve efficiency in monitoring and managing paint spills, unlocking new market opportunities.
1. What is a paint absorbent?
Paint absorbent is a material designed to soak up and contain excess paint or spills in industrial or construction environments.
2. What industries use paint absorbents?
Industries such as civil construction, electronics manufacturing, automotive, and furniture production use paint absorbents to manage excess paint and prevent spills.
3. Are paint absorbents eco-friendly?
Many paint absorbents are designed to be biodegradable and eco-friendly, helping to reduce environmental impact.
4. How do paint absorbents work?
Paint absorbents work by using materials with high absorbent properties that capture and contain liquid paints, preventing spills from spreading.
5. What types of paint absorbents are available?
Paint absorbents come in various forms, such as pads, mats, sponges, granules, and wipes, designed for different applications.
6. Can paint absorbents be used on all types of paints?
Yes, paint absorbents can be used on various types of paints, including water-based, solvent-based, and oil-based paints.
7. Are paint absorbents reusable?
Some paint absorbents are reusable, while others are single-use, depending on the material and level of saturation.

11. How are paint absorbents disposed of?
Paint absorbents should be disposed of according to local environmental regulations, with some products being recyclable or biodegradable.
12. Can paint absorbents be used in electronics manufacturing?
Yes, paint absorbents are used in electronics manufacturing to manage paint spills without damaging sensitive components.
13. What is the lifespan of a paint absorbent?
The lifespan depends on the type of absorbent and the amount of paint it has absorbed, with some being reusable and others single-use.
14. Are paint absorbents suitable for industrial use?
Yes, paint absorbents are widely used in industrial settings, including automotive, aerospace, and heavy machinery industries.
15. What materials are used to make paint absorbents?
Paint absorbents are often made from natural fibers, synthetic materials, or non-woven fabrics designed for high absorbency.
